Exploring 5-axis CNC machines can seem intimidating at first glance, but these machines reshaping manufacturing across a range of industries. Different from traditional 3-axis systems, a 5-axis mill offers the ability to rotate the workpiece in five distinct directions, enabling highly complex shapes and reducing the need for numerous setups. Such increased flexibility results in improved exactness, quicker lead times, and a expanded range of functional outcomes.
CNC Router 5-Axis Technology: Advantages and Implementations
Contemporary 5-axis CNC router technology provide a major improvement in manufacturing capabilities. Unlike traditional 3-axis routers, these devices allow for intricate parts to be created in a few setup, decreasing cycle time and improving total efficiency. Common uses cover aerospace components, automotive molds, medical devices, architectural prototypes, and premium furniture. The power to shape multiple sides simultaneously leads to better surface finishes and fewer material loss, allowing them a critical resource for numerous industries.
